What is Flavoured milk made of?

Flavored milk is a sweetened dairy drink made with milk, sugar, flavorings, and sometimes food colorings.

Which country drinks the most Flavoured milk?

Australia has the highest consumption rate of flavored milk in the world, standing at 9.5 L (2.5 US gal) per capita in 2004.

Who created strawberry milk?

In 1948, Nestlé launched a drink mix for chocolate-flavored milk called Nestle Quik in the USA. They released their strawberry version in 1968.

Which country produces milk first?

India is the world’s largest milk producer, with 22 percent of global production, followed by the United States of America, China, Pakistan and Brazil.

Why do Chinese not drink milk?

With increased globalization, the desire for milk is mounting in China, despite the fact a high proportion of Asians are lactose-intolerant or lactase-deficient—meaning they lack sufficient lactase, the enzyme necessary to absorb the sugar in milk, lactose, and may suffer from diarrhea, gas, and bloating after …
